Long guard; I like watching him play. Thing, but can play. Reminds me a little bit of Eron Harris at the same age.

Shot very well (around 43%) from deep in EYBL regular season play.. we'll see how he does this week. Had some outrageous games (first 3 of the year he was 13/15 3FG).. had another string of 6 games in which 5 he was 0-for from deep (0/18 total).. but in one game of those six, he lit up McQuaid & GRANDSTAFF's team for 33 pts thanks in part to 7/11 3FG shooting. The homeboy Malachi had 28 in that one.

Nice looking player.. I've followed Malachi a bit for quite some time, but Alston really caught my eye this spring on numerous occasions. Word is Shawn.
